20001011001599 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 20001011001600. Its totient is φ = 20001011001598.
The previous prime is 20001011001577. The next prime is 20001011001613. The reversal of 20001011001599 is 99510011010002.
It is a strong prime.
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 20001011001599 - 28 = 20001011001343 is a prime.
It is a Sophie Germain prime.
It is a congruent number.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(20001011001509)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 10000505500799 + 10000505500800.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(10000505500800).
Almost surely, 220001011001599 is an apocalyptic number.
20001011001599 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
20001011001599 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
20001011001599 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 810, while the sum is 29.
